The Head of Accounts will lead the accounting department, ensuring compliance with financial regulations, overseeing financial reporting, and managing audit processes.
Job Summary:
Our client, who is a manufacturing company, is seeking a highly experienced and qualified Head of Accounts to lead their accounting department.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in accounting and finance, with proven expertise in financial reporting, auditing, and tax compliance. This role requires an individual with excellent leadership skills to oversee the department while ensuring the accuracy and integrity of the company’s financial records.
Responsibilities:
- Oversee all accounting operations, ensuring compliance with financial regulations and standards.
- Prepare, review, and finalize financial statements and management reports.
- Monitor company cash flow, budgeting, and financial planning activities.
- Ensure timely and accurate financial reporting to the company's directors.
- Coordinate internal and external audits, ensuring smooth audit processes and adherence to compliance requirements.
- Manage tax planning and compliance, including accurate filing of VAT, corporate tax, and other statutory obligations.
- Implement strong internal controls to protect company assets and ensure regulatory compliance.
- Lead and mentor the accounting team, providing support and development opportunities.
- Supervise daily accounting functions such as accounts payable/receivable, payroll, and reconciliations.
- Collaborate with other departments to ensure alignment of financial data with overall company goals.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ance,
or a related field (Master’s degree or CPA/ACCA certification is an added
advantage).
- Minimum of 10 years of experience in
accounting, with at least 5 years in a leadership role.
- Strong knowledge of Tanzania’s financial
regulations, tax laws, and audit processes.
- Proficiency in accounting software and
financial reporting tools.
- Excellent leadership, communication, and
problem-solving skills.
- Ability to work under pressure and meet
tight deadlines.
